Teeth discoloration is a typical dental concern that affects many people and often causes them to be conscious about their smile. Learning about its causes can help you take steps to avoid it and maintain your teeth's natural brilliance. Let's take a closer look at these factors and how to address them effectively.
One of the most common causes of teeth discoloration is dietary habits. Consuming foods and beverages like tea, coffee, red wine, and dark berries can lead to staining. These items contain chromogens, which are color-producing substances that adhere to the enamel.
Rinsing your mouth with water after consuming these foods and drinks helps minimize staining. You can also use a straw for beverages to reduce the contact of fluids with your teeth.
Another significant cause of teeth discoloration is smoking or using tobacco products. Tobacco contains tar and nicotine, which can cause teeth to turn yellow or brown. Quitting smoking not only improves general health but also aids in preserving teeth's whiteness.
Inadequate brushing, flossing, and irregular dental visits can lead to plaque buildup and tartar, which can cause teeth to appear yellow. Establishing a diligent oral hygiene routine and scheduling regular cleaning appointments with your dentist can help prevent discoloration.
Antibiotics like tetracycline and doxycycline have the potential to stain the teeth of children whose teeth are still developing. Some antipsychotic drugs, antihistamines, and blood pressure medications can also cause discoloration. If you are concerned about medication-induced discoloration, you may discuss alternatives with your healthcare provider.
Aging is another factor that naturally leads to teeth discoloration. As we age, the enamel on our teeth wears down, revealing the yellowish dentin beneath. While this is natural, maintaining good oral hygiene can slow it down.
Preventing teeth discoloration starts with understanding its causes and taking simple steps to address them.
